# Find libepoxy
#
# EPOXY_INCLUDE_DIR
# EPOXY_LIBRARY
# EPOXY_FOUND
find_path(EPOXY_INCLUDE_DIR NAMES epoxy/gl.h PATHS /opt/vc/include)
set(EPOXY_NAMES ${EPOXY_NAMES} epoxy)
find_library(EPOXY_LIBRARY NAMES ${EPOXY_NAMES} PATHS /opt/vc/lib)
include(FindPackageHandleStandardArgs)
find_package_handle_standard_args(EPOXY DEFAULT_MSG EPOXY_LIBRARY EPOXY_INCLUDE_DIR)
mark_as_advanced(EPOXY_INCLUDE_DIR EPOXY_LIBRARY)

@ -80,6 +80,9 @@ header instead of the regular OpenGL header.
`GLFW_INCLUDE_ES31` makes the GLFW header include the OpenGL ES 3.1 `GLES3/gl31.h`
header instead of the regular OpenGL header.
`GLFW_INCLUDE_EPOXY` makes the GLFW header include the libepoxy `epoxy/gl.h`
header instead of the regular OpenGL header.
`GLFW_INCLUDE_NONE` makes the GLFW header not include any OpenGL or OpenGL ES API
header. This is useful in combination with an extension loading library.
